  • Muslims praying. Photo: REUTERS/Muhammad Hamed Amid COVID-19, HRC "Memorial"* demands to protect Muslims' rights at funerals in KBR

    The Human Rights Centre (HRC) "Memorial"* has appealed to the Prosecutor's Office of the Kabardino-Balkarian Republic (KBR) with a request to check information on the violation of the rights of relatives of the Muslims who died from COVID-19. KBR residents tell about burying the dead in closed coffins, without observing religious rites and traditions, the HRC's message says.

  • Participants of protest rally in Baku. Screenshot from Sevindj Sadygova's Facebook page In Baku, police suppress women's protest in defence of political prisoners

    Today, about 10 women have come to the US Embassy. They demanded to release political prisoners. In their hands, the activists were holding posters with the slogan "Freedom for political prisoners!" written in Azerbaijani and English, as well as posters with photos of sentenced activists and journalists, the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ent reported.

  • Dmitry Peskov. Photo: REUTERS/Evgenia Novozhenina Peskov forwards material about extrajudicial executions in Chechnya to law enforcers

    Today, while commenting on the material about victims of the extrajudicial executions released by the newspaper "Novaya Gazeta", Dmitry Peskov, the press secretary for the President of Russia, has said that the newspaper's material cannot be considered as evidence of extrajudicial executions and that law enforcers should deal with such information.
